White Flower Farm Dublin Bay Rose
Best vibrant blooms for consistent garden beauty.
This award-winning climber offers a continuous display of velvety red, semi-double blooms on vigorous stems. It's known for its reliability and disease resistance, making it a low-maintenance choice for trellises and pergolas. While it needs sun and fertile soil, its beauty and ease of care are well worth the effort.

Performance breakdown
Bloom consistency
Reliable flowering on both old and new wood ensures season-long color.
Disease resistance
Robust genetics keep foliage healthy with minimal intervention required.
Growth vigor
Rapid, strong stems quickly cover trellises and vertical garden structures.
Visual impact
Velvety red blossoms provide a classic, high-contrast focal point.
Establishment ease
Bareroot shipping requires careful timing but rewards with strong root development.
Climbing versatility
Flexible canes adapt easily to various support structures like pergolas.
Key Specs
Common Name
Climbing Rose
Hardiness Zone
5-9S/10W
Exposure
Sun
Blooms In
Jun-Oct
Mature Height
8-12'
Spacing
5-7'
Ships as
BAREROOT
Grafted
